DENVER — Partly cloudy skies cover Colorado and the temperatures are mild. Highs reached well into the 60s on the plains with 40s to low 50s in the mountains.

Skies will remain partly cloudy tonight and Friday with low temperatures in the 40s for Denver and the eastern plains and 20s to near 30 degrees in the mountains.

Friday will be a delightful day - a perfect Opening Day for the Rockies with partly cloudy skies and highs in the 60s. There will be a 10% chance of isolated storms later in the day. The lower atmosphere is pretty dry, so the storms will be high-based, bringing mainly gusty winds and a little thunder, but only brief rainfall.

A weak storm system will move across the central Rockies on Saturday, with a better chance for showers and thunderstorms and some snow for the mountains.

Temperatures will be in the 60s on Saturday on the plains, with 40s in the mountains.

Skies will clear on Sunday and mild, dry pleasant weather will hold through Tuesday on next week. Highs will be in the 60s to near 70 degrees early next week in Denver, while the mountains reach the 50s.

Another storm system may bring some rain and snow to Colorado by the middle of next week. This storm may be stronger and have the potential for heavy mountain snow and possible snow in Denver and across northeastern Colorado.
